Transaction 527738b6247280d97efa235c5a59f30bbee489344139752532b4ccdff2b744ab

1 Input
2 Outputs
  • 527738b6247280d97efa235c5a59f30bbee489344139752532b4ccdff2b744ab:0
  • value  1677187
    address  16kdcWskPMFSr4TcEqmjaSim2ix27ckRD5
  • 527738b6247280d97efa235c5a59f30bbee489344139752532b4ccdff2b744ab:1
  • value  1959150339
    address  1FtKRN4aEvW9g7QWD2NH7ST8TFAmqDfTg7